Uppsala University, founded in 1477 and based in the historic city of Uppsala, is Sweden's oldest university and a leading global research institution. With about 50,000 students, including roughly 6,000 international learners, the university offers a broad portfolio of 119 programs across the sciences, humanities, social sciences, and professional fields. The Bachelor in Game Design and Programming at Uppsala University is a 3-year program that provides skills in developing games for commercial production. It's for students who want to understand how games work and how they affect society. You'll learn to develop games using current and future technology, and practice producing games with students from other disciplines.
The curriculum includes courses like Game Design 1, Game Production 1, and Systems Design. You'll develop skills in programming, game development, and game analysis. The program also provides training in expression through text, imagery, and games, as well as verbal communication. You'll work on projects that help you build a network of contacts in the industry.
After graduating, you can pursue careers like Game Programmer, Game Designer, Software Engineer, Game Developer, or Tools Programmer. You can work in the game industry, tech, or entertainment. The program has a good reputation internationally, and past students have won prizes at the Swedish Game Awards.
